vCloud Air and MongoDB Atlas cater to cloud-based solutions but serve distinct roles: vCloud Air provides infrastructure-as-a-service, while MongoDB Atlas offers database-as-a-service, making them complementary. MongoDB Atlas is often favored for its features and reliability, despite vCloud Air being noted for better pricing options.
Features: vCloud Air integrates seamlessly within existing VMware environments, offering scalability and flexibility for infrastructure management. It provides enhanced integration capabilities, especially for VMware users. MongoDB Atlas supports robust database management with features like automated backups, scalability, and global cloud distribution. Its advanced data management and handling capabilities set it apart as superior in database functionalities.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: MongoDB Atlas offers an effortless deployment model with full automation and flexibility across major cloud platforms, simplifying ongoing management. Proactive customer support is a strong point for MongoDB Atlas. vCloud Air provides straightforward integration for VMware environments but may require more manual configuration. MongoDB Atlas generally stands out in deployment simplicity and customer support promptness.
Pricing and ROI: vCloud Air is noted for competitive pricing, especially for organizations already utilizing VMware infrastructure. Although MongoDB Atlas is perceived as more costly, it delivers strong ROI thanks to its advanced features and efficient database management. While vCloud Air presents a more economical option, MongoDB Atlas's comprehensive service and capabilities justify its higher cost for extensive database solutions.
MongoDB Atlas stands out with its schemaless architecture, scalability, and user-friendly design. It simplifies data management with automatic scaling and seamless integration, providing dynamic solutions for diverse industries.
MongoDB Atlas offers a cloud-based platform valued for its seamless integration capabilities and high-performance data visualization. It features advanced security options such as encryption and role-based access control alongside flexible data storage and efficient indexing. Users benefit from its robust API support and the ability to manage the platform without an extensive setup process. Feedback suggests improvements are needed in usability, query performance, security options, and third-party tool compatibility. While pricing and support services could be more economical, there is a demand for enhanced real-time monitoring and comprehensive dashboards, as well as advanced containerization and scalability options supporting complex database structures.
